Man burned in Provo 7-Eleven trash bin fire dies

An Orem man has died after suffering burns over 80 percent of his body in a trash bin fire.

Kathy Wilets, spokeswoman for University Hospital's Burn Unit in Salt Lake City, confirmed that 22-year-old Sean Ryan Romero was pronounced dead at 5:32 a.m. Wednesday.

Meanwhile, investigators continued to seek answers to questions about how the fire began, engulfing Romero outside a 7-Eleven store in Provo on Monday afternoon.

Provo police Lt. Matthew Siufanua said witnesses were able to put out the flames with fire extinguishers from the store, but Romero had already been extensively burned by that time.

Provo Fire Marshal Lynn Schofield said it could take several weeks to complete the investigation.
